Grimorium verum [Les Véritable Clavicules de Salomon], [translated by Plaingierre], Memphis: Alibeck, 1517 [i.e. 18th century], 12°, 2 folding engraved plates (one plate dampstained and torn, affecting the first illustration on the plate, spotted), later half calf (chipped and rubbed), partly uncut.
Provenance
F. G. Irwin, bookplate.

Lot Essay

An 18th-century reprint of Grimorium verum.
